PHOTO SETTINGS Sets the options of the PHOTO mode Delay Instant 10s 1m 3m 5m 10m 15m 30m Allows the user to choose the time interval between each detection before the camera records the next photo A longer delay minimizes the number of photos taken and maximizes the battery life A shorter delay maxi mizes the number of photos taken but requires more battery power The Shorter times interval are recommended when the camera is used for security purposes Multi shot 1 2 3 4 5 6 consecutive shots Takes up to 6 consecutive shots at each detection with a 10 second delay between each photo This option allows the user to get up to 6 photos from different angles when the camera is in PHOTO mode Recommended settings The camera can be configured for usage in trails This situation usually presents low activity level fast subjects and a small number of photos is expected These settings increase the chances of capturing animals that follow each other The camera can also be configured for usage at a feeder s site This situation usually presents high activity level slow subjects and a large number of photos is expected These settings moderate the number of photos taken while capturing overall activity on feeder s site Here is a table showing the suggested settings for each situation Feeder Instant Delay Multi shots 1 2 3 When these recommended settings are not adapted to the situation

11. battery life can be affected 12 tS TIME LAPSE SETTINGS Sets the options of the TIME LAPSE mode Interval 30s 1m 3m 5m 15m 30m th Allows the camera to take photos at regular preset intervals For example if the option 5m is selected in the TIME LAPSE mode the camera takes a photo every 5 minutes even if there is no detection This option allows the user to obtain photos of game outside the detection range of the camera Note The TIME LAPSE mode only applies for photos not videos When the TIME LAPSE mode is selected the DELAY option and the MULTI SHOT mode are disabled VIDEO SETTINGS m Sets the options of the VIDEO mode Delay 10s 1m 3m 5m 10m 15m 30m Allows the user to choose the time interval between each detection before the camera records the next video A longer delay minimizes the number of videos taken and maximizes the battery life A shorter delay maximizes the number of videos taken but requires more battery power The shorter times interval are recommended when the camera is used for security purposes Video length 10s 30s 60s 90s Allows the user to select the duration of the recording when the camera is set in VIDEO mode Photo first When this option is enabled a photo is taken immediately before each video Note The file name of the photo corresponds to the digit before the video file name For example if the name of the photo is PICT001 the name of the video will be PICT002 Set

13. d turn it on again The camera beeps e Insert a memory card The camera does not respond e Remove the batteries and reinstall them Replace alkaline batteries or recharge the lithium battery pack Impossible to take photos videos e Verify if there are batteries in the camera e Replace alkaline batteries or recharge the lithium battery pack Verify if the camera is turned on Red light in front of the camera blinks e Camera is set in TEST mode e Camera is set in PHOTO or VIDEO mode The red light in front of the camera flashes for 60 seconds to allow the user to leave without being photographed or recorded 16 No person animal on photos e Sunrise or sunset can trigger the sensor Camera must be re orientated e At night the motion detector may detect beyond the range of the IR illumination Reduce sensibility setting Small animals may trigger the unit Reduce sensibi lity setting and or raise height of camera e Motion detector may detect animals through foliage e If a person or animal moves quickly it may move out of the camera s field of view before the photo is taken Move the camera further back or redirect the camera e Make sure the mounting post or tree is stable and does not move Error messages Error message Possible solutions Insert memory card The use of a memory card is reguired to record photos and videos Card error The

15. lect and the 5 button to return to the previous menu PHOTO Allows the user to take photos When the PHOTO mode is selected the test light in front of the camera will flash for 60 seconds and a countdown will appear on the screen to allow the user to leave the area without being photographed NM VIDEO Allows the user to take videos When the VIDEO mode is selected the test light in front of the camera will flash for 60 seconds and a countdown will appear on the screen to allow the user to leave the area without being recorded TEST M Allows the user to test the detection system of the camera When the TEST mode is selected no photo or video is recorded Walk perpendicularly in front of the camera When the camera detects a movement the busy light and the test light blink to indicate that normally a photo or video would have been recorded If the system does not detect the movement increase the detection distance using the Sensitivity option in the settings menu Realigning the camera can also be required In TEST mode it is possible to take a photo by pressing the OK button FORCE 12 only The photo is saved and appears in the VIEW mode 10 INSTALLATION WITH THE SUPPLIED STRAP Use the mounting bracket or the camera slot for installation strap to fix the camera The dimensions of the strap included is 1 X 60 Recommended installation height about 3 feet above the ground Do not place the camera f
